It's actually a touch more banged up than it shows in those. Lotta buckle dings and dents on the backside.
From what I learned, Gibson did three RD models. The Standard didn't have any active circuitry. Oddly, most of the RDs I hear about now that did have that active circuitry had it replaced during its lifetime. Granted, I'm working from a pretty small sample size. The RD Standard is a lot like a longer scale (Fender-length) reverse Firebird. This whole thing was nicely timed, as I'd been looking for a solidbody electric to play in standard tuning (my Tele is kept in a funky tuning and refuses to play right any other way) but didn't want anything plain-Jane.
This thing is definitely NOT plain-Jane.
